Impedanssikokeet, known in English as impedance spectroscopy or electrochemical impedance spectroscopy (EIS), are a powerful electrochemical technique used to study the behavior of electrochemical systems over a range of frequencies. The core principle involves applying a small amplitude sinusoidal voltage or current to an electrochemical cell and measuring the resulting current or voltage response, respectively. By analyzing the impedance, which is the frequency-dependent opposition to the flow of alternating current, researchers can gain insights into various electrochemical processes occurring within the system.
